ALBUQUERQUE, N.M. — Temperatures felt as cold as -10° and only warm as 25° to start what is going to be a chilly Wednesday across New Mexico.
This likely won’t last as temperatures are expected to get back into the 50s and 60s by the end of the week. It just won’t be Wednesday.
